With 24,081 people, ZIP 30528 is a ZIP code in White County. Four-year degrees are less common here than nationally, at 22% of adults. The median age is 43.6, about 5 years above the US median. 78% of homes are owner-occupied. The foreign-born share is 3%. The typical home is worth $274,000.
How many people live in ZIP code 30528?
ZIP code 30528 has about 24,081 residents according to the 2024 American Community Survey.
What is the median household income in ZIP code 30528?
The typical household in ZIP code 30528 earns about $70,873 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is ZIP code 30528 expensive?
In ZIP code 30528, the median home is worth about $274,000, and the typical rent is about $1,035 a month.
How educated are people in ZIP code 30528?
About 22.3% of adults age 25 and over in ZIP code 30528 h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in ZIP code 30528?
About 13.5% of people in ZIP code 30528 live below the federal poverty line.
